Roles & Permissions
Zesty.io base roles and permissions
User Roles and Permissions are applied to a user or Team access through the Accounts instance settings drawer. Role permissions range from limiting the types of resources a user can access to whether they can save, create, delete, or publish contents.
All users are managed by an Owner or Admin user roles. Access and permissions are specific to an individual user's role on a single instance. If they are a member of a team, their access will be limited to the team's role as its assigned on an instance.
Note: Leads in the screenshot below is only visible if an instance has form that uses Zesty's ZLF
All roles have access to publishing/unpublishing and deleting content except for the Contributor role.
Base Roles Types
Owner
Full access to all sections: Content, Schema, Media, Code, Leads, Redirects, Reports, Apps, and Settings.
In Accounts they have full access as well which includes the ability to: launch instances, add domains, invite new users and set their roles, add a team, and create tokens.
Admin
An Admin has the same privileges as the Owner role except for deleting other users.
Developer
Access to Content, Schema, Media, Code, Leads, Redirects, Reports, Apps, and Setting section.
SEO
Access to Content, Media, Leads, Redirects, Reports, and Apps section.
Publisher
Access to Content, Media, Leads, Reports, and Apps section.
Contributor
Access to Content, Media, and Apps section.
Contributors can create and edit but they cannot publish content. To publish new content, contributors must submit a workflow request to a user with publishing access.
Contributors can access media and add files, but they cannot delete files.
In addition to the above, Zesty.io has release two new base roles: Developer Contributor, Access Admin
Developer Contributor
This is similar to the Developer with access to Content, Schema, Media, Code, Leads, Redirects, Reports, Apps, and Setting section. The only difference is that this role cannot do publish.
Updated 2 months ago